CVE-2017-9747

37
FAUCET Score

CVE-2017-9747 is a buffer overflow vulnerability in the ieee_archive_p function of GNU Binutils' libbfd library (version 2.28). This flaw allows remote attackers to trigger a denial of service (application crash) or potentially other unspecified impacts by processing a specially crafted binary file, for example, using "objdump -D". Rated 7.8 HIGH, the vulnerability requires local access and user interaction (e.g., opening a malicious file) but can lead to high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impacts. While not actively exploited in the wild and lacking significant community discussion or media coverage, a public exploit (EDB-42200) demonstrating a stack buffer overflow exists.
